Repose is the first album of Jiri Slavik and Fred Thomas, an acoustic duo (double bass and piano) of two musicians, who met during their studies at the Royal Academy of Music. Inspired by the artistic approach of people like Benoît Delbecq, Mark Dresser or Peter Herbert, their work exhibits a vast degree of influences, ranging from Gamelan and African Music to modern Jazz, Ligeti and Messiaen. In order to enlarge the possibilities of their respective instruments and hence to enrich the sound of their ensemble as a whole, both players use unconventional techniques or physical preparations, which modify the final sound production to a considerable degree and thus create textures of a multi-instrumental nature.
"The textural range of the duo is impressive, and Slavik's arco playing in particular is exemplary; this is music requiring patience and application, but it is rich and original enough to reward both." (Chris Parker, Vortex Review)
